test pipe
I checked out the search button regarding this mod. It seems like ppl agree that the diameter of the tp should be the same as exhaust. Currently, I have a stock exhaust and I don't think i'll be changing my exhaust anytime soon (gf won't let me). any recommendations for test pipe to go along with my stock exhaust?

BUT, if you must keep her I think there is a way to make both of you happy. There are many wonderful exhausts that are VERY close to as quiet as the stock system while still looking great and giving you a slight performance gain while saving you a good bit of weight.
The system that I would recommend you look at is the Tanabe Medalion Touring....
then an invidia TP would go wonderfully with that system...
